学习目标:
php算法学习小记
学习内容:
1.基础算法之选择排序
学习时间:
2020-12-17
学习产出:
代码:
$arr = [2,6,3,4,1,8,7,9];
$count = count($arr);
if($count < 2){
return $arr;
}
for ($i=0; $i < $count - 1; $i++) {
$key = $i;
for ($j=$i + 1; $j < $count; $j++) {
if($arr[$key] < $arr[$j]){
$key = $j;
}
}
if($key != $i){
$temp = $arr[$key];
$arr[$key] = $arr[$i];
$arr[$i] = $temp;
}
}
print_r($arr);die;